Skip to main content

2013 | OriginalPaper | Buchkapitel

4. A Genetic Programming Approach for Image Segmentation

verfasst von : Hugo Alberto Perlin, Heitor Silvério Lopes

Erschienen in: Computational Intelligence in Image Processing

Verlag: Springer Berlin Heidelberg

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

This work presents a methodology for using genetic programming (GP) for image segmentation. The image segmentation process is seen as a classification problem where some regions of an image are labeled as foreground (object of interest) or background. GP uses a set of terminals and nonterminals, composed by algebraic operations and convolution filters. A function fitness is defined as the difference between the desired segmented image and that obtained by the application of the mask evolved by GP. A penalty term is used to decrease the number of nodes of the tree, minimally affecting the quality of solutions. The proposed approach was applied to five sets of images, each one with different features and objects of interest. Results show that GP was able to evolve solutions of high quality for the problem. Thanks to the penalty term of the fitness function, the solutions found are simple enough to be used and understood by a human user.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literatur
1.
Zurück zum Zitat Bhanu, B., Lin, Y.: Object detection in multimodal images using genetic programming. Appl. Soft Comput. 4(2), 175–201 (2004)CrossRef Bhanu, B., Lin, Y.: Object detection in multimodal images using genetic programming. Appl. Soft Comput. 4(2), 175–201 (2004)CrossRef
2.
Zurück zum Zitat Bojarczuk, C., Lopes, H., Freitas, A., Michalkiewicz, E.: A constrained-syntax genetic programming system for discovering classification rules: application to medical data sets. Artif. Intell. Med. 30(1), 27–48 (2004)CrossRef Bojarczuk, C., Lopes, H., Freitas, A., Michalkiewicz, E.: A constrained-syntax genetic programming system for discovering classification rules: application to medical data sets. Artif. Intell. Med. 30(1), 27–48 (2004)CrossRef
4.
Zurück zum Zitat Davis, J.W., Keck, M.A.: A two-stage template approach to person detection in thermal imagery. In: Proceedings of the Seventh IEEE Workshops on Application of Computer Vision, vol. 1, pp. 364–369 (2005) Davis, J.W., Keck, M.A.: A two-stage template approach to person detection in thermal imagery. In: Proceedings of the Seventh IEEE Workshops on Application of Computer Vision, vol. 1, pp. 364–369 (2005)
5.
Zurück zum Zitat Frucci, M., Baja, G.S.: From segmentation to binarization of Gray-level images. J. Pattern Recognit. Res. 3(1), 1–13 (2008) Frucci, M., Baja, G.S.: From segmentation to binarization of Gray-level images. J. Pattern Recognit. Res. 3(1), 1–13 (2008)
6.
Zurück zum Zitat Goldberg, D.E.: Genetic Algorithms in Search, Optimization, and Machine Learning. Addison-Wesley, Reading (1989)MATH Goldberg, D.E.: Genetic Algorithms in Search, Optimization, and Machine Learning. Addison-Wesley, Reading (1989)MATH
7.
Zurück zum Zitat Gonzalez, R.C., Woods, R.E.: Digital Image Processing, 3rd edn. Prentice-Hall, Upper Saddle River (2006) Gonzalez, R.C., Woods, R.E.: Digital Image Processing, 3rd edn. Prentice-Hall, Upper Saddle River (2006)
8.
Zurück zum Zitat Koza, J.R.: Genetic Programming: On the Programming of Computers by Means of Natural Selection. The MIT Press, Cambridge (1992) Koza, J.R.: Genetic Programming: On the Programming of Computers by Means of Natural Selection. The MIT Press, Cambridge (1992)
9.
Zurück zum Zitat Kwon, S.: Threshold selection based on cluster analysis. Pattern Recognit. Lett. 25(9), 1045–1050 (2004)CrossRef Kwon, S.: Threshold selection based on cluster analysis. Pattern Recognit. Lett. 25(9), 1045–1050 (2004)CrossRef
10.
Zurück zum Zitat Leibe, B., Leonardis, A., Schiele, B.: Robust object detection with interleaved categorization and segmentation. Int. J. Comput. Vis. 77(1–3), 259–289 (2008)CrossRef Leibe, B., Leonardis, A., Schiele, B.: Robust object detection with interleaved categorization and segmentation. Int. J. Comput. Vis. 77(1–3), 259–289 (2008)CrossRef
11.
Zurück zum Zitat Martel-Brisson, N., Zaccarin, A.: Kernel-based learning of cast shadows from a physical model of light sources and surfaces for low-level segmentation. In: IEEE Conference on Computer Vision and, Pattern Recognition, pp. 1–8 (2008) Martel-Brisson, N., Zaccarin, A.: Kernel-based learning of cast shadows from a physical model of light sources and surfaces for low-level segmentation. In: IEEE Conference on Computer Vision and, Pattern Recognition, pp. 1–8 (2008)
12.
Zurück zum Zitat Otsu, N.: A threshold selection method from gray-level histograms. IEEE Trans. Syst. Man Cybern. 9(1), 62–66 (1979)MathSciNetCrossRef Otsu, N.: A threshold selection method from gray-level histograms. IEEE Trans. Syst. Man Cybern. 9(1), 62–66 (1979)MathSciNetCrossRef
14.
Zurück zum Zitat Shapiro, L.G., Stockman, G.C.: Computer Vision. Prentice-Hall, New Jersey (2001) Shapiro, L.G., Stockman, G.C.: Computer Vision. Prentice-Hall, New Jersey (2001)
15.
Zurück zum Zitat Silva, R.: Erig Lima, C., Lopes, H.: Template matching in digital images using a compact genetic algorithm with elitism and mutation. J. Circuits Syst. Comput. 19(1), 91–106 (2010)CrossRef Silva, R.: Erig Lima, C., Lopes, H.: Template matching in digital images using a compact genetic algorithm with elitism and mutation. J. Circuits Syst. Comput. 19(1), 91–106 (2010)CrossRef
16.
Zurück zum Zitat Xu, X., Xu, S., Jin, L., Song, E.: Characteristic analysis of Otsu threshold and its applications. Pattern Recognit. Lett. 32(7), 956–961 (2011)CrossRef Xu, X., Xu, S., Jin, L., Song, E.: Characteristic analysis of Otsu threshold and its applications. Pattern Recognit. Lett. 32(7), 956–961 (2011)CrossRef
17.
Zurück zum Zitat Zhang, H., Fritts, J., Goldman, S.: Image segmentation evaluation: a survey of unsupervised methods. Comput. Vis. Image Underst. 110(2), 260–280 (2008)CrossRef Zhang, H., Fritts, J., Goldman, S.: Image segmentation evaluation: a survey of unsupervised methods. Comput. Vis. Image Underst. 110(2), 260–280 (2008)CrossRef
Metadaten
Titel
A Genetic Programming Approach for Image Segmentation
verfasst von
Hugo Alberto Perlin
Heitor Silvério Lopes
Copyright-Jahr
2013
Verlag
Springer Berlin Heidelberg
DOI
https://doi.org/10.1007/978-3-642-30621-1_4